Dr Rajeev Chalasani is an accomplished ophthalmologist specialising in retinal diseases and conditions such as macular degeneration, diabetic retinopathy, and vein occlusion. Based in Hurstville, New South Wales, Australia, Dr Chalasani has established himself as a leading expert in his field.
Dr Chalasani obtained his Bachelor of Optometry (Honors), Bachelor of Medicine, Bachelor of Surgery (Honors), and Master of Public Health (Honors) degrees from the University of New South Wales. He graduated with First Class Honors, showcasing his dedication and exceptional academic abilities.
After completing his internship and junior medical years at Concord Hospital in Sydney, Dr Chalasani served as a medical registrar at St. Vincent’s Hospital Sydney, as well as at Broken Hill Hospital and Shoalhaven District Memorial Hospital. These experiences provided him with a diverse range of clinical exposure and helped shape his expertise.
Dr Chalasani furthered his training in ophthalmology at two prestigious institutions in Australia, Sydney Eye Hospital and the Royal Victorian Eye and Ear Hospital in Melbourne. Additionally, he pursued a comprehensive fellowship in Medical Retina and Uveitis at Bristol Eye Hospital in the United Kingdom, renowned for its excellent ophthalmic care.
As a Fellow of The Royal Australian and New Zealand College of Ophthalmologists, Dr Chalasani is recognized for his extensive knowledge and high level of expertise. He is also a member of the Australian and New Zealand Society of Retinal Specialists, further highlighting his commitment to staying up to date with the latest advancements in the field.
Dr Chalasani holds the position of Staff Specialist at Westmead Hospital Sydney, where he provides comprehensive medical management for various retinal conditions. He has actively participated in major international clinical trials focused on researching retinal diseases, demonstrating his dedication to advancing medical knowledge and improving patient care.
In addition to his clinical work, Dr Chalasani is passionate about teaching. He actively contributes to the education and training of medical students, optometrists, and general practitioners. This commitment to sharing knowledge and expertise ensures that he is at the forefront of training the next generation of medical professionals.
Dr Chalasani's enthusiasm for medical technology led him to complete a Master's degree in Biomedical Engineering at the University of New South Wales. This interdisciplinary background allows him to leverage cutting-edge technology in his practice, delivering the highest standard of care to his patients.
Furthermore, Dr Chalasani is a lifetime member of St John Ambulance Australia and has been involved in providing first aid and medical services at numerous public events. This dedication to the well-being of others extends beyond his medical practice and showcases his commitment to the community.
